java socketio有哪些注意事項(xiàng)
小樊
82
2024-07-20 19:34:04
- 需要確保使用的Socket.io版本與應(yīng)用程序的其他組件兼容。
- 在使用Socket.io時(shí),要避免出現(xiàn)跨域請(qǐng)求的問(wèn)題??梢酝ㄟ^(guò)設(shè)置CORS(跨域資源共享)來(lái)解決。
- 在部署Socket.io應(yīng)用程序時(shí),要確保服務(wù)器端和客戶端之間的連接是穩(wěn)定和可靠的。
- 要注意處理連接丟失或斷開(kāi)的情況,以便及時(shí)重新連接或處理斷開(kāi)連接的情況。
- 在使用Socket.io時(shí),要注意處理數(shù)據(jù)的傳輸和解析,確保數(shù)據(jù)的完整性和準(zhǔn)確性。
- 要注意處理異常情況和錯(cuò)誤,盡量避免程序崩潰或出現(xiàn)不可預(yù)料的情況。
- 在進(jìn)行Socket.io編程時(shí),要注意多線程并發(fā)的問(wèn)題,確保線程安全和數(shù)據(jù)一致性。
- 在編寫(xiě)Socket.io應(yīng)用程序時(shí),要考慮安全性和隱私保護(hù),避免出現(xiàn)數(shù)據(jù)泄露或惡意攻擊的情況。